A key assumption the thing makes is that race is a social and no longer a organic assemble. Basu justifies this assumption by means of declaring that “nearly all of genetic variation related to race-specific characteristics exists inside racial teams and no longer between them.”
The find out about additionally makes use of an ‘equality of alternative’ framework. This manner has been broadly utilized in economics (see Roemer 2002, Becker 1971) in addition to in different fields. Principally, within the EO framework, results rely on folks have instances (e.g., age, gender, race, parental source of revenue) which might be in large part out of doors in their regulate of people in addition to their very own efforts. There’s inequality of alternative every time results fluctuate throughout instances when effort is held consistent.
The Basu paper, then again, notes that effort will not be a complete selection variable as there is also limitations to folks making efforts–specifically up to now–which might collect and alter circumstance over the years and lead to worse well being results even with similar efforts within the present duration. Basu concludes that whether or not race must be integrated in scientific prediction algorithms will depend on the objective of the set of rules.
…in sensible settings, failure to incorporate race corrections will propagate systemic inequities and discrimination in any diagnostic style and particular prognostic fashions that tell selections by means of invoking an ex ante repayment theory. Against this, together with race in prognostic fashions that tell useful resource allocations following an ex ante praise theory can compromise the equality of alternatives for sufferers from other races. In such settings, race is more likely to proxy for differential efforts throughout those teams, which unobserved differential instances can form. Even if race isn’t integrated, discrimination might be a part of any algorithms predicting long term results used to plan an ex-ante praise coverage, even if together with race exacerbates this drawback.
The thing comprises each formal derivations of circumstances when it’s and isn’t applicable to incorporate race/ethnicity in a scientific set of rules relying on whether or not this can be a diagnostic (present) or prognostic (long term prediction) set of rules and whether or not the set of rules is used to spot present problems, or praise efficiency. As an example, CMS in large part has no longer integrated race in value-based supplier repayment since doing so would reason high quality of care requirements to change by means of race; then again CMS does monitor retrospectively variations in well being results throughout races to spot doable problems as a diagnostic software, then again.
